Having lost a lot of weight recently, I'm going through a wardrobe update.

Mostly, I work from home, sometimes on site, but for a few weeks a year I need to be very formal and totally polished doing demos at a trade show or sales visits.

I like wearing dress suits, but also trouser suits.

But I can't find tops to go with the trouser suits - theres lots of floppy chiffon blouses that look rubbish on me, and I'm not keen on formal shirts.

I'm 40, silver haired, 5'9, size 10 trouser, size 12 top, 30FF norks.

Any ideas?

The main issue with suit tops is the length as you need something that is shorter than the suit jacket. I would opt for a cream top with a lace front. There are lots around - check out mango or oasis
